Fabric Choices and Comfort Level
Cotton Breathability and Softness
High-quality cotton offers natural breathability and a gentle feel against the skin. Opt for long-staple fibers like Supima or Pima for enhanced softness and durability in a navy blue queen comforter set.
Microfiber Performance and Easy Care
Microfiber provides a wrinkle-resistant, easy-to-maintain option without sacrificing a luxe appearance. It holds up well to frequent use and is ideal for busy households seeking low-maintenance bedding.

Can I machine wash a down alternative navy comforter?
Most down alternative comforters are machine washable, but always check the care label. Use a gentle cycle with mild detergent and tumble dry on low to preserve loft.

Is a higher thread count always better for a navy blue set?
Higher thread count often means a smoother feel, but prioritize fabric type and weave. A 300 to 600 thread count range typically balances comfort and durability for cotton sets.
